The Science of Stale: How Distance Diminishes Your Drink

To understand the local advantage, you must first understand what happens to coffee when it’s not fresh. After roasting, coffee beans release carbon dioxide in a process called degassing. This is natural and necessary, but as days turn into weeks, oxygen seeps in and oxidizes the oils and compounds that give coffee its character. The result is a flat, dull, or papery taste that no amount of cream or sugar can fix.

Professional roasters agree that coffee is at its absolute best within a narrow window—typically the first two to four weeks after roasting.
